Social media features, content to be examined in case on teen mental health

By Xu Yuan ( August 6, 2025, 22:17 GMT | Comment) -- Ahead of the first trial in the US on social media’s role in the deterioration of young people’s mental health, scheduled for November, a state court in Los Angeles has once again been confronted with the question of to what extent the content on social media can be separated from features of the apps.Ahead of the first trial in the US on social media’s role in the deterioration of young people’s mental health, scheduled for November, a state court in Los Angeles is once again confronted with the question of to what extent the content on social media can be separated from features of the apps....
